Established around 1880, this third-class royal monastery features a distinct blend of Sino-Portuguese architecture. The expansive grounds include 11 pagodas and several large chedis. A significant religious artifact preserved on-site is a 700-year-old golden Buddha statue.
The site functions as an active monastery and a school for monks. It also serves as the headquarters for both the Phuket Buddhist Association and the Phuket Old Town Foundation.
Beyond its religious and educational roles, the temple acts as a venue for community cultural events. These include the Niramit Night of Blessings temple fair, which features traditional performances, local food stalls, and outdoor cinema screenings.
